Outline of Final Research Achievements |
The vessels and hub ports used in maritime logistics of container are dynamically determined depending on various factors such as weather condition or the sudden increase of amount of containers. Aiming supervising such dynamically changing freight plans, we have developed a freight management system that can not only monitor the handling of containers with RFID devices but also confirms the correctness of it by modeling whole the freight plans with Multiple Ambient Calculus(MAC) that is a kind of process algebra. We have also developed a model checking system that confirms the model satisfies the properties expected to the freight plan that dynamically changes.
